Do you lack structure in your evenings? If you do, why don't you attempt a summer evening routine?
The summer season is the time for holidays, bbqs, beach trips and picnics. It is all about enjoying the sun, getting outside and spending quality time with loved ones, which is exactly why it is many people's most favourite time of year. In spite of the laid back nature of the season, it is still essential to have a few kind of routine and structure to your regular work day. This is where having a summer routine in the evening can be extremely handy and beneficial. In regards to what makes a good evening routine in the summer, one of the most essential facets is your eating practices. As alluring as it may be to order check here a takeaway when you get home from work, it is far better for your health to cook your dishes from square one, using fresh ingredients. This is because fast food and various other processed foods include high calorific consumption, high salt and sugar content and different other artificial additives. By cooking your dishes from the ground up, you have absolute control over what you are eating. Since the weather is usually hotter during summer, it is an excellent idea to stick to light, simple meals which aren't too stodgy or heavy. When people get home from the office, all they want to do is plop themselves in front of the tv. Whilst it is certainly crucial to unwind after a long, busy and demanding day, it is just as important to keep your body active and fit. This is especially the instance for those who have very stationary careers where they spend hours at their desks. This is precisely why every summer evening routine ought to include some kind of exercise, even if it is only 15-30 minutes. After all, research states that around half an hour of exercise daily, together with healthy eating, is the key to living a healthy lifestyle. This should not change just because it is the summer season; your health and fitness must always be a top priority. Consequently, you should always set aside some time for your day-to-day exercise when creating an evening routine in the summer; it could be a walk, jog or bike ride around the neighbourhood at sundown, an evening swim at your local health club, or even some yoga in your back yard. Asides from the physical and mental benefits of evening exercise, the appeal of exercising at this time is that the temperature is much cooler and it boosts your sleep quality. Similarly, it is likewise crucial that your summer nighttime routine sets aside ample time for actual sleep. With the sun setting later during summer, many individuals wind up going to bed at a much later time than usual, which implies that they do not feel well rested, energised or focused the next day. To avoid this, one of the best pointers is to switch off your mobile phones to minimise the blue light exposure, then pick up a book instead. Reading before bed has proven to be great for our mental and physical health, which is why it must be near the top of your evening routine checklist.
